What is Private Psychiatry?
Private psychiatry refers to mental health services private health services delivered by psychiatrists who run outside of the National Health Service (NHS). These professionals offer assessments, assessments, and treatments for a variety of mental health problems, consisting of anxiety, depression, PTSD, and more serious psychiatric disorders.

Just how much does it cost to see a private psychiatrist in the UK?
The cost can differ significantly depending upon location and the psychiatrist's experience. Typically, preliminary consultations may range from ₤ 200 to ₤ 400, and follow-up visits can cost in between ₤ 100 and ₤ 300.
2. Is private psychiatric care covered by medical insurance?
Many medical insurance policies cover private psychiatric care, but it's vital to validate protection details and look for pre-approval for services.
